Prior to our trip to Frankfurt, my husband and I wanted to make sure to visit one of the German towns with an old-time feel. My husband knows what a planner I am, so he knew I would find something interesting. After researching various towns, I discovered Marburg!
Located a little over an hour away from Frankfurt via the train, the voyage there and the scenery was beautiful. Since Frankfurt is the financial district of Germany, this was a nice change of pace. When pulling into the Marburg train station, you will get to see the gorgeous, majestic St. Elizabethkirsch. The station is centrally located, so the church and the Christmas market are both within walking distance.
The Christmas market is throughout this tiny town, but start at the church. The market encircles the church, full of pretty lights, jolly music, items to buy and food to experience!
The market does not end there... remember to walk up the hilly road. Pockets of markets throughout the town, full of happy people, alcohol to enjoy, and memory-making experiences! We thoroughly enjoyed our time at the Christmas market! read more
